靜壓軸承之單向薄膜節流器特性參數之鑑別

Identification for Characteristic Parameters of Single-action Membrane-type Restrictors Used in Hydrostatic Bearings

摘要


本文以實驗方法鑑別薄膜節流器之節流參數及薄膜變形係數,探討此型節流器補壓靜壓軸承工作壓力的特性,實驗使用自行開發的節流係數測量儀,其構造近似1種開式靜壓軸承的工作平台,用來校準及量測節流器進口壓力、出口壓力及流量,使實驗量測的流量與鑑別計算的流量誤差平方最小的聯立方程式求解,得以鑑別薄膜節流器參數。由於單向薄膜節流器之設計構造使兩個參數均隨供壓而變,因此再以最小誤差方法由參數鑑別值,得到供壓函數的多項式回歸係數。

並列摘要


This paper studies identification method for restriction parameter and deformation parameter of membrane for single-action membrane-type restrictors. A worktable mounting on open-type hydrostatic bearing is designed for the calibrations and the measurements of the inlet pressure, the outlet pressure, and flow rate for the restrictors. Solving combined equations due to minimizing the difference between measured flow and identified flow gives restrictor parameters. Further, the method of least square error is used to regress the polynomials coefficients of supplied pressures.
